About Colleen Downey

Colleen Downey is a licensed psychodynamic therapist and psychotherapist based in the United Kingdom who draws on six years of clinical experience to support people facing emotional challenges. She works with individuals experiencing depression, stress and anxiety, relationship difficulties, trauma and abuse, and eating disorders, approaching each person's situation with respect for their existing strengths and life story.

Colleen believes that people are the experts on their own lives and that therapy is a collaborative process that builds on personal resilience. She emphasizes a supportive, empowering approach that helps clients take the first steps toward meaningful change and greater well-being. Her orientation in psychodynamic therapy offers a space to explore underlying patterns, relational dynamics, and the emotional roots of current struggles.

Could remote therapy be a good fit?

Many people wonder whether meeting with a therapist online can really help. For many common concerns - including stress, anxiety, depression, relationship challenges, and navigating life changes - online therapy has been shown to be comparable in effectiveness to traditional in-person sessions.

One major benefit of remote therapy is flexibility. Individuals can connect with a licensed professional in the way that suits them best - by video call, phone session, live chat, or in-app messaging - which can make it easier to access support without rearranging daily commitments.

Therapists offering remote work are licensed professionals, and clients may choose to switch providers if they feel another fit would be more helpful. Online sessions can expand access to therapy while preserving the clinical foundations of traditional care.
